XML 77 R65.htm IDEA: XBRL DOCUMENT v3.22.0.1
Share-Based Compensation - Summary of Stock-Based Compensation Expense (Details) - USD ($)
$ in Thousands
12 Months Ended
Dec. 31, 2021
Dec. 31, 2020
Dec. 31, 2019
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]      
Total pre-tax stock-based compensation expense charged against income $ 8,827 $ 7,872 $ 6,865
Total recognized tax (deficiency) benefit related to share-based compensation (217) (293) 196
Stock options      
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]      
Total pre-tax stock-based compensation expense charged against income 1,832 2,134 2,623
Restricted stock, restricted stock units and deferred stock units      
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]      
Total pre-tax stock-based compensation expense charged against income 6,367 5,195 3,967
Performance stock units      
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]      
Total pre-tax stock-based compensation expense charged against income 401 0 0
Employee Stock Purchase Plan      
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]      
Total pre-tax stock-based compensation expense charged against income $ 227 $ 543 $ 275